hbase针对full gc所做的优化方法是什么

2023-04-23 15:03:00 优化 方法 所做

HBase是一种基于列存储的开源、分布式的NoSQL数据库,它可以支持大规模的数据存储和处理。由于HBase的特殊存储结构,它在处理大数据方面有着独特的优势。但是,HBase也存在一些问题,其中最严重的一个问题就是Full GC所带来的性能问题。HBase的Full GC可能会导致系统性能下降,严重时甚至会导致系统崩溃。因此,HBase针对Full GC所做的优化方法变得尤为重要。

首先,HBase可以通过调整JVM堆内存大小来优化Full GC。当HBase的堆内存设置得过大时,它会导致Full GC的发生频率增加,从而影响系统性能。因此,HBase可以通过调整JVM堆内存大小来减少Full GC的发生频率,从而提高系统性能。

其次,HBase可以通过增加RegionServer的数量来优化Full GC。当RegionServer的数量过少时,它会导致Full GC的发生频率增加,从而影响系统性能。因此,HBase可以通过增加RegionServer的数量来减少Full GC的发生频率,从而提高系统性能。

此外,HBase还可以通过增加Region的数量来优化Full GC。当Region的数量过少时,它会导致Full GC的发生频率增加,从而影响系统性能。因此,HBase可以通过增加Region的数量来减少Full GC的发生频率,从而提高系统性能。

最后,HBase可以通过降低数据写入频率来优化Full GC。当数据写入频率过高时,它会导致Full GC的发生频率增加,从而影响系统性能。因此,HBase可以通过降低数据写入频率来减少Full GC的发生频率,从而提高系统性能。

总之,HBase可以通过以上几种方法来优化Full GC,从而提高系统性能。调整JVM堆内存大小、增加RegionServer的数量、增加Region的数量以及降低数据写入频率,都可以有效地帮助HBase优化Full GC,从而提高系统性能。

相关文章